Students are loving the new supplies, from hula hoops to white boards and markers. Every grade level is benefiting from your donations.\r\n\r\nThe white boards and markers have been used in various ways. 5th graders have used them for their \"Dancing With the Elements\" unit where they used action words to create movement and practiced brainstorming individually and in small groups. 3rd graders use them to take notes during their ballet unit. From time to time students use them to draw when they need to refocus or when they get out during a whole class game of \"Night at the Museum.\" They are used daily!\r\n\r\nThings like the hula hoops, bean bags, and parachute have added so much excitement to our lower grade dance classes. The hula hoops provide boundaries for learning personal space and help create fun obstacle courses. The bean bags are used for learning balance, creativity, and coordination. The parachute is used in all grades for learning team work and group coordination, as well as counting, rhythm, and keeping a beat. \r\n\r\nA few other items that are worth mentioning! The magnetic timer helps us track time as a whole class, comes in handy during games, and especially helps students who need to track the minutes to stay focused and engaged. Our mini bookshelf holds all of our lower grade books and looks great with our new classroom setup.\r\n\r\nYour donations have greatly impacted our 500 + students who walked into dance this year excited to see all of the new, colorful items. When they learned that \"strangers\" donated them they felt loved and grateful. They rushed at the chance to write thank you cards. Honestly, they can't keep their hands off the supplies. \r\n\r\nWe will continue to build on our dance units and how we incorporate these tools! About this school
Marcy Open School is
an urban public school
in Minneapolis, Minnesota that is part of Minneapolis Public Schools.
It serves 415 students
in grades K - 5 with a student/teacher ratio of 9.4:1.
Its teachers have had 64 projects funded on DonorsChoose.
